美文网首页
多维数组转一维数组

多维数组转一维数组

作者: 流觞小菜鸟 | 来源:发表于2019-12-18 20:46 被阅读0次
<!DOCTYPE html>
<html lang="en">

<head>
    <meta charset="UTF-8">
    <meta name="viewport" content="width=device-width, initial-scale=1.0">
    <meta http-equiv="X-UA-Compatible" content="ie=edge">
    <title>Document</title>
</head>

<body>
    <script>
        //第一种
        // var arr = [
        //     [1, [1, 1, 1], 2, 3],
        //     [2, 3, 4],
        //     [5, 6, 7]
        // ]
        // console.log(arr.flat(Infinity))
        //  第二种
        //  var arr = [
        //     [1, [1, 1, 1], 2, 3],
        //     [2, 3, 4],
        //     [5, 6, 7]
        // ]
        // let arr1 = arr.toString().split(',')
        // let arr1 = arr.join().split(',')
        // console.log(arr1)
        // 第三种
        // var arr1 = [
        //     [0, 1],
        //     [2, 3],
        //     [4, 5]
        // ];
        // var arr2 = [].concat.apply([], arr1);
        // console.log(arr2)
        // 第四种
        var arr1 = [
            [0, 1],
            [2, 3],
            [4, 5]
        ];
        var arr2 = arr1.reduce(function (a, b) {
            return a.concat(b)
        });
        // console.log(arr2)
    </script>
</body>

</html>

相关文章

  • JS方法数组方法reduce方法常用实例总结

    数组求和 数组项相乘 数组项计数 数组项去重 多维维数组转一维数组 数组对象指定字段求和 示例代码

  • 2018-10-03

    多维数组转一维 结果log

  • 多维数组

    创建多维数组 多维数组可以看成是数组的数组,二维数组是最基本的多维数组。 要创建多维数组,请将每个数组放在其自己的...

  • php多维混合数组转一维数组的函数

    php多维混合数组转一维数组的函数 php语言本身没有将多维数组转为一维数组的函数,但是我们可以自己写一个php函...

  • JS数组方法速查

    1.数组去重 2.数组合并 3.数组排序(sort) 4.多维数组转一维数组(flat) 5.过滤数组(filte...

  • 4.3~1多维数组

    多维数组可以看作是数组的数组,如果将多维数组看作是比较特殊的一维数组,那数组的元素本身就是数组。在学习多维数组之前...

  • 学习Java第五天

    数组是多个数据的集合 数组的语法 数组元素类型【】 数组名; 多维数组: 数组元素类型【】【】 数组名; 多维数组...

  • 多维数组转一维数组

    法一:使用数组map()方法,对数组中的每一项运行给定函数,返回每次函数调用的结果组成的数组。 ``` var a...

  • 多维数组转一维数组

  • 多维数组转一维数组

    方法一 方法二

网友评论

      本文标题:多维数组转一维数组

      本文链接:https://www.haomeiwen.com/subject/ygfpnctx.html